What Are Tariffs?
Tariffs are taxes imposed by governments on imported or exported goods. They serve to protect domestic industries but can lead to increased costs for businesses and consumers.
Types of Tariffs
There are two main types of tariffs: ad valorem tariffs, based on the value of goods, and specific tariffs, based on the quantity of goods.
Effects of Tariffs on Businesses
Tariffs can have various effects on businesses engaged in global trade.
Increased Costs
Businesses may face increased costs due to tariffs, which can affect pricing strategies and profit margins.
Changes in Supply Chains
Companies may need to adjust their supply chains to mitigate the impact of tariffs, possibly sourcing from different countries.
